Overview:
Bundaberg Central is a suburb located in the city of Bundaberg, Queensland, Australia. It is situated approximately 385 kilometers north of Brisbane, the state capital. Bundaberg Central is known for its vibrant city center, historical buildings, and a range of amenities and attractions.
Transport & Access:
Bundaberg Central is easily accessible by various modes of transportation. The suburb is well-connected by road, with the Bruce Highway passing nearby, providing easy access to other parts of Queensland. The Bundaberg Railway Station is also located in the suburb, offering train services to Brisbane and other regional areas. Additionally, the Bundaberg Airport is situated just a short drive away, providing domestic flights to major cities in Australia.

Things to Do:
Bundaberg Central offers a range of activities and attractions for residents and visitors. Some popular things to do in the area include:
1. Bundaberg Rum Distillery: Take a tour of the famous Bundaberg Rum Distillery and learn about the history and production of this iconic Australian spirit.
2. Hinkler Hall of Aviation: Explore the life and achievements of Australian aviation pioneer Bert Hinkler at this interactive museum.
3. Bundaberg Botanic Gardens: Enjoy a leisurely stroll through the beautiful gardens, featuring a variety of plants, picnic areas, and a Japanese tea house.
4. Moncrieff Entertainment Centre: Catch a live performance, movie, or exhibition at this cultural hub in the heart of Bundaberg Central.
